Grant L. MacConnell, 53
Grant L. MacConnell, 53, died Jan. 5 at Beth Israel Deaconess Medical Center in Boston after a long illness. He was the husband of Michelle B. (Gordon) MacConnell.
Born in Newton, he was the son of Robert MacConnell of Braintree (former athletic director, Marshfield High School) and the late Lois (Lanzetta) MacConnell. A graduate of Marshfield High School, he was a previous resident of Plymouth before moving to Wareham 10 years ago.
Grant worked in systems security for CVS in Woonsocket, RI. He was also owner of the former Onset Bay Blues Cafe in Onset. He enjoyed blues music and was a bass player. He was also a motorcycle enthusiast and a member of the Cape Cod Chapter Harley Owners Group. His other interests included boating, playing pool, and golf.
Grant was former president of the Cape Cod Chapter of ABATE political action committee for bikers' rights.
Survivors include his wife, his father, and his son, Grant L. MacConnell, Jr., of Plymouth; his daughter, Stephanie MacConnell of Plymouth; his sister, Susan McKenney of Braintree; his grandson, Lucas MacConnell, and his dog “Lilly.”
